Disadvantages of Private Purchases
Health Risks: Sellers may not constantly disclose health issues, so it's crucial to assess the bird's well-being and request veterinary records.

Restricted Support: After the sale, personal sellers may not offer support or recommendations for care and training.

Verification Issues: It's vital to make sure that the seller is credible, as not all personal sellers are credible.

Lack of Documentation: Private sales may not include important documents, such as pedigrees or health guarantees.

Schedule: Depending on the types you have an interest in, discovering a private seller can take some time and persistence.

Research study Species Before starting yoursearch, invest time in learningabout various parrot species. Each species has distinct needs, sizes, and characters. Popular choices include African Greys, Macaws, Cockatoos, and Budgerigars. 2. Set a Budget Create a reasonable spending plan that includes the preliminary purchase price, ongoing expenses for
food, environment, toys, and veterinary care. 3. Try To Find Reputable Sellers Make use of community forums, social media groups, or local bird clubs
to find reliable sellers. Belonging to an online parrot neighborhood can offer valuable insights. 4. Ask Questions Do not hesitate to ask the seller concerns about the parrot's history, diet plan, habits, and factor for sale. A responsible seller
will more than happy to share this information. 5. Go to the Bird Whenever possible, visit the parrot personally. This allows you to evaluate the seller's environment and the bird's living conditions. 6. Evaluate Health & Behavior Try to find any indications of health problem such as sleepiness, plume plucking, or respiratory issues. A healthy parrot should have intense eyes, a tidy vent area, and active habits. 7. Obtain & Necessary Documentation Ask for any offered documentation about the bird's breeding, health history, and vaccinations. This can be vital for continuous care. 8. Prepare Your Home Before bringing a parrot home, develop a safe, stimulating
environment that includes a cage, toys, and perches. 9.
